海洋水文是研究海洋中的水体运动、水质和水文特征的科学领域。作为一名在海洋行业从事多年的专家,我对海洋水文有着丰富的经验和见识。在实践中,我们经常需要绘制图像来展示数据,以便更好地理解和分析海洋水文现象。而MATLAB作为一种功能强大的计算和可视化软件,在海洋水文研究中也起到了重要的作用。今天我将为大家介绍如何使用MATLAB绘制图像APP,以及一些实用技巧。
u) A4 ?0 {$ G1 K* g9 G
$ O8 {+ y0 ]+ [% _* ~9 G. Z% k首先,让我们来了解一下MATLAB中绘图的基本原理。MATLAB提供了丰富的绘图函数和工具,可以满足不同需求的绘图任务。其中,绘制二维图像的函数主要包括plot、scatter、bar等,而绘制三维图像的函数则包括surf、mesh、contour等。除了这些基本函数,MATLAB还提供了众多的辅助函数和工具箱,如颜色映射、标注、图例等,可以帮助我们更好地定制和美化图像。
% u8 T0 u* Z h$ h- R I# p" O$ G, P
在使用MATLAB绘图之前,我们首先需要准备数据。海洋水文研究中常见的数据类型包括水深、海浪高度、海洋流速等。这些数据可以通过仪器观测、数值模拟或者其他方法获得。在MATLAB中,我们可以将这些数据保存在矩阵或向量中,然后通过调用相应的绘图函数进行可视化。: ]. J$ }! j9 M1 k
, x/ `& ^ T1 h6 u; L接下来,让我们进入MATLAB的绘图APP。在MATLAB的主界面上,我们可以找到“图形”菜单,其中包含了各种绘图工具和函数。点击“图形”菜单,然后选择“图像处理工具箱”下的“Image Viewer”子菜单,即可打开绘图APP窗口。! T5 L& O9 s" e$ g' } X
5 x1 g3 ^, O2 c6 K w b绘图APP提供了一个直观且易于使用的界面,使得我们可以轻松编辑和修改图像。在绘图APP窗口中,我们可以通过加载数据文件或手动输入数据来创建图像。然后,我们可以通过调整参数,比如颜色、线型、标签等,来定制图像的外观。同时,绘图APP还提供了一系列的交互式工具,如缩放、平移、旋转等,以便我们更好地查看和分析图像。, R! J' z8 J! h; a, b+ u# [
7 B2 O/ u& s8 k6 Q$ [除了基本的绘图功能,MATLAB的绘图APP还支持一些高级功能。例如,我们可以在图像中添加注释、箭头或区域感兴趣等,以增加图像的信息量和可读性。此外,我们还可以通过选择不同的颜色映射、调整阈值等,来快速生成具有较高视觉效果的图像。* {5 k, s! f3 M4 Q- X* t5 s, q
3 C. f6 ]) |% ]( O i. M1 n
在实际应用中,MATLAB的绘图APP可以发挥出很大的优势。例如,在海洋水文调查中,我们经常需要根据浮标或遥测数据绘制水深图、海浪图等,以分析海洋运动的规律和特点。使用MATLAB的绘图APP,我们可以快速生成这些图像,并通过交互式操作进行进一步分析。1 ]; K: o+ u$ J& C7 [# E
( Z/ r. p9 L, h7 s" L总之,MATLAB绘图APP是一款非常实用的工具,在海洋水文研究中有着广泛的应用。通过灵活的参数设置和交互式操作,我们可以轻松地创建、修改和分析图像,从而更好地理解和解释海洋水文现象。希望我今天的介绍能够对正在从事海洋水文研究的各位科研人员有所帮助。 |